Preguntas frecuentes sobre sistemas multiagente (MAS)

Los sistemas multiagente (MAS) son sistemas computacionales compuestos por múltiples agentes inteligentes interactivos, cada uno con capacidades y objetivos específicos, que colaboran para resolver problemas complejos.

Los agentes de un MAS interactúan a través de protocolos de comunicación, compartiendo información, negociando tareas y coordinando sus acciones para lograr objetivos colectivos o individuales.

Los beneficios incluyen capacidades mejoradas de resolución de problemas para tareas complejas, mayor robustez y tolerancia a fallos, escalabilidad mejorada y capacidad de aprovechar la experiencia especializada de los agentes individuales.

Las aplicaciones incluyen optimización de la cadena de suministro, redes inteligentes, gestión del tráfico, robótica de enjambre, comercio financiero y ecosistemas de servicio al cliente complejos.

Las tareas se distribuyen entre los agentes en función de sus capacidades, su carga de trabajo actual y los objetivos generales del sistema, lo que a menudo implica negociación y asignación dinámica.

Los desafíos incluyen diseñar protocolos de comunicación eficaces, garantizar la coordinación y la cooperación entre los agentes, gestionar posibles conflictos y evaluar el rendimiento en todo el sistema.

En un sistema multiagente, un mecanismo de coordinación es un método o protocolo que permite que varios agentes autónomos trabajen juntos de manera efectiva, gestionen sus interacciones y alcancen objetivos comunes o individuales. Los mecanismos de coordinación pueden incluir técnicas como la negociación, la asignación basada en subastas o la planificación centralizada, que ayudan a los agentes a sincronizar sus acciones, resolver conflictos y optimizar su rendimiento colectivo. Estos mecanismos son cruciales para garantizar que los agentes operen de manera coherente y eficiente dentro del sistema.